I have had Sky+ installed now for a couple of weeks (previously had NTL digital). I had the dish mounted on the back of my house on a bracket about two feet long - as the dish had to face nearly horizontal to the wall.
I have been extremely disapointed with the picture quality. The picture on all channels (but more nociable on football/golf shows etc) exhibits random horizontal flickering which moves up and down the screen in no particualr order. It's very distractiing and annoying.
I had the Sky engineers come out and they claimed that this sort of interference is standard with Sky and I should just accept it. However having been round to my parents house (who are just a mile away) they do not have any of this flickering and the picture is fine. I am connecting to my TV via RGB (the same lead as used for NTL which did not have any of these problems).
Also the picture tends to freeze quite a lot sometimes as much as once every 5 minutes.
Has anyone experienced these porblem, or know whether they are solvable? I'd be very grateful as at this rate am thinking about going back to NTL digital - which just goes to show you how annoying the problem is.
